K-pop girl group LE SSERAFIM have teased new music, releasing a trailer for a project titled ‘Hot’.
Today (February 17), LE SSERAFIM and their label Source Music dropped a teaser clip titled ‘I’m Burning Hot’. The 30-second video features a refreshed animation of LE SSERAFIM’s logo, while also teasing the release date and title of their next project ‘Hot’.
According to a statement by Source Music to Korean news outlet OSEN, ‘Hot’ will be LE SSERAFIM’s fifth mini-album. The project is due out on March 14 at 1pm KST. Details about the project, including its tracklist, title track and more, are expected in the coming weeks.

‘Hot’ will mark LE SSERAFIM’s first release of 2025, coming about seven months after their August 2024 project ‘Crazy’. That mini-album featured a title track of the same name, as well as the song ‘1800-hot-n-fun’, which the girl group debuted live during their Coachella 2024 set.
‘1-800-hot-n-fun’ would later be named one of the 25 best K-pop song released in 2024 by NME, with NME’s Daniel Anderson writing: “‘1-800-hot-n-fun’ isn’t just a direct line to the girl group; it’s the track you’ll have on repeat and on speed dial for a wild night out.”
In other K-pop news, girl group aespa and BLACKPINK member Jennie were both named as honourees at this year’s Billboard Women in Music Awards, to be held at the YouTube Theater in Los Angeles on March 29.
aespa were awarded the Group of the Year award while Jennie was honoured with the Global Force award, making them the only K-pop artists among the ceremony’s selection of winners this year.
